Makengo transferred to Udinese

OGC Nice and Udinese have reached agreement on the transfer of Jean-Victor Makengo.

After going out on loan to Toulouse FC for the 2019/20 season, Jean-Victor Makengo is making a permanent move away from OGC Nice. The midfielder is going to discover a new league after signing for Italian club Udinese.

After coming through the Stade Malherbe de Caen youth academy, he made his Ligue 1 debut at 17 and joined Le Gym in summer 2017. On the Côte d'Azur, he played 30 top-flight games, including 25 during the 2018/19 season, scoring once, and he featured in two Europa League games the previous campaign.

After 76 Ligue 1 matches, Jean-Victor Makengo, 22, now has a new challenge in Udine with the side coached by Luca Gotti and which is currently 19th in the Italian league.
